Abstract:
Natural Language Interface to Database (NLIDB) translates human utterances into SQL queries and enables database interactions for non-expert users. Recently, neural network models have become a major approach to implementing NLIDB. However, neural NLIDB faces challenges due to variations in natural language and database schema design. For instance, one user intent or database conceptual model can be expressed in various forms. However, existing benchmarks, using hold-out datasets, cannot provide thorough understanding of how good neural NLIDBs really are in real-world situations and its robustness against such variations. A key difficulty is to annotate SQL queries for inputs under real-world variations, requiring considerable manual effort and expert knowledge. To systematically assess the robustness of neural NLIDBs without extensive manual effort, we propose MT-Teql, a unified framework to benchmark NLIDBs against real-world language and schema variations. Inspired by recent advances in DBMS metamorphic testing, MT-Teql implements semantics-preserving transformations on utterances and database schemas to generate their variants. NLIDBs can thus be examined for robustness utilizing utterances/schemas and their variants without requiring manual intervention. We benchmarked nine neural NLIDBs using 62,430 inputs and identified 15,433 defects. We analyzed potential root causes of defects and conducted a user study to show how MT-Teql can assist developers to systematically assess NLIDBs. We further show that the transformed (error-triggering) inputs can be used to augment popular NLIDBs and eliminate 46.5%(±5.0%) errors made by them without compromising their accuracy on standard benchmarks. We summarize lessons from this study that can provide insights to select and design NLIDBs that fit particular usage scenarios.

Abstract:

Leber´s hereditary optic neuropathy (LHON), a disease affecting vision, is caused by several point mutations in mitochondrial DNA. Mutations leading to a defect NADH ubiquinone oxidoreductase protein will affect the respiratory chain and cause a disturbed ATP production. It is still unknown why this defect leads to the degeneration of retinal ganglion cells and cells in the opticus nerve as well as demyelination of axons in these areas. Analysis of mitochondrial DNA is an important tool in the diagnosis of the disease. At the present time analysis is based on cleavage by restriction enzymes, which only detects two of the most frequent mutations: m.3460G>A and m.11778G>A. This is far too few considering that more than 30 mutations are known to be associated with LHON. Therefore a new analysis method is requested. Here we describe a method based on the sequencing of the mitochondrial genes MT-ND1, MT-ND4 and MT-ND6, which will detect more than 15 different point mutations associated with the disease. To validate the analysis, DNA from 31 patients with LHON symptoms were sequenced; of these 10 were found to be positive for a LHON mutation. This result indicates that the sequencing analysis will be more effective in diagnosis of LHON than restriction enzymes.

In this work we study the ferromagnetic behavior of a series of multilayer ZnO / MT with MT = Fe, CoFe, NiFe. Such systems are important for applications in spintronics: theoretical calculations in multilayer of ZnO/Co with fixed ZnO thickness of 5 nm show that these structures can have up to 100% spin polarization. The multilayers with structure of [ZnO (5nm) / MT (t)] x6 were grown by means of magnetron sputtering varying the thickness of the MT with the values of t = 0,3; 0,4; 0,6; 0,8 and 1, 0 nm. The crystallographic structure is analyzed by X-ray diffractometer (XRD) and the results revealed a preferential growth of ZnO along (002) plane, enlargement of the width of the peaks and existence of satellite peaks. The topography is analyzed with the atomic force microscope (AFM) and it reveals a relationship between the thicknesses of the MT layers and the surface imperfections. The static magnetic response was analyzed with a vibrating sample magnetometer (VSM) and magnetization curves as a function of field (M vs. H) and as a function of temperature (Mvs. T) using the zero field cooling measurements (ZFC) and field cooling (FC) were obtained. The shapes of hysteresis curves show the changes of a film with strong dipolar interactions to a system of non-interacting nanoparticles according to the "concentration" of MT in the multilayer. Measurements of ZFC / FC M-T curves confirm that the ferromagnetic order is favored in the samples with thicker deposited MT layers. The dynamic magnetic response was analyzed by ferromagnetic resonance spectroscopy (FMR) and it shows the decrease of the resonance field in the series, which is due to the shape anisotropy, showing a change of the easy axis of magnetization from in plane to the perpendicular of the plane. The chemical analysis is done by X-ray photoemission spectroscopy (XPS) and the result shows the formation of mixed phases (ions) of the MT. Transmittance measurements reveal the existence of a peak of plasmon in the range of 250 to 340 nm. These peaks of plasmon are characteristic dielectric systems with nanoparticles. Heat treatment for the sample of [ZnO (5nm) / Fe (t)] x6 has been done at 600oC for 2 hours in vacuum in order to increase the thickness of diluted magnetic semiconductor (SMDs) layers in the multilayer system due to the diffusion process of MT atoms. These systems show changes in their structural and magnetic properties, which can be due to the appearance of SMDs since the magnetic behavior does not match to a film or to a granular system.

The motivation of this work was to verify the possibility of modifying clays with silane to replace commercial clays or calcium carbonate, which is an automotive industry traditional filler, in order to avoid thermal contraction and reduce the flammability of these composites without compromising the mechanical properties of the final material. In order to avoid agglomeration and improve the interaction of Cloisite® Na+ montmorillonite (Mt) with an unsaturated polyester matrix, this study focused on the modification of clay minerals with vinyltriethoxysilane (VTES) and γ-methacryloxypropyltrimethoxysilane (MPS) silanes, and their use in two- and three-component composites in comparison with those prepared using commercial clays (Cloisite® 30B and Cloisite® 15A). Three component composites of polyester/glass fiber/clay were also analyzed in comparison with composites prepared with calcium carbonate filler. Clays were dispersed in the resin by mechanical stirring and sonication and the composites were prepared by resin transfer molding (RTM). Functionalization of Cloisite®Na was confirmed by the appearance of characteristic bands in the infrared analysis and the increase in basal spacing. The advantages of using silane-modified clays compared with commercial organic-modified clays in two-component composites can be summarized as higher storage modulus and improved adhesion to the polyester resin with associated higher thermal deflection temperature and reinforcement effectiveness at higher temperatures. However, nanocomposites prepared with organic modified clays showed better dispersion (tendency to exfoliate) and consequently delayed thermal volatilization due to the clay barrier effect. In three-component composites, the coefficient of thermal expansion showed reduced values for silane-modified samples. All the composites decomposed at lower temperatures in air and their degradation behavior differed from those exposed to nitrogen. The composites with clays showed improved fire performance, with shorter fire duration and slower fire growth, along with better mechanical properties than those with traditional calcium carbonate filler. Therefore, MPS modified and non-modified commercial Cloisite® 30B are indicated in future studies.

Abstract:
Machine translation (MT) is experiencing a renaissance. On one hand, machine translation is becoming more common and used in ever larger scale, on the other hand many translators have an almost hostile attitude towards machine translation programs and those translators who use MT as a tool. Either it is assumed that the MT can never be as good as a human translation or machine translation is viewed as the ultimate enemy of the translator and as a job killer. The article discusses with various examples the limits and possibilities of machine translation. It demonstrates that machine translation can be better than human translations – even if they were made by experienced professional translators. The paper also reports the results of a test that showed that translation customers must expect that even well-known and expensive translation service providers deliver a quality that is on par with poor MT. Overall, it is argued that machine translation programs are no more and no less than an additional tool with which the translation industry can satisfy certain requirements. Mato Grosso continues to be a must in the domestic and foreign media since it has been considered the Brazilian state with the largest deforested area in the last 15 years (1992-2007) due to the enlargement of the agribusiness field. This fact, among others, has generated a political discomfort in the state and it has generated a process of decentralization of part of the foresting policy in 1999, previously conducted by the federal government. In 2000, the Rural Proprieties Environmental Licensing System (SLAPR, in Portuguese) was created, and it brought out the use of remote sensor technology as well as a geographical information system in proprieties licensing. For some time, the results of such policy were analyzed along with its development process, the reasons and conflicts for its use in the state of Mato Grosso, which is also known for its high cattle raising production. The period of analysis was from 2000 to 2008. It was clear that, despite decentralization, there was not an organized process of participation with the local community in order to implement and/or modify such policy, becoming a “centralized decentralization” in the bureaucratic body of the state. As to the result of the policy reflected in the deforestation rates in the state, it was plain to see that there was no difference in the amount of deforestation inside and outside SLAPR during this time, except those legal cases that occurred in the system, outside the legal reserves. The top of such legal affair occurred in 2002, when 71% of the deforestation above 200 hectares in the state was authorized. These results, and the interviews with the people involved in the creation of the SLAPR, show that there was an “economical plan” behind the implementation of the system that, somehow, would legitimate the production of the state, by means of an “effective” environmental policy. The technology involved in the policy symbolized both “state control” and “transparency” to the “globalized world”, which demanded guarantees over the legal origin of the products from the state. However, from 2003 on, this economical project ceased, leaving ground to the grand increase in the deforestation rate in the state. Since then, the policy results have been defective in many aspects, since the legal condition in the deforestation rate authorized by SEMA reached 4% of the total carried out in the state in 2007. Such difficulty in understanding this economical project by the productive sector and the new state government staff, from 2003 on, caused a negative reaction in the SLAPR and exposed more accurately the conflicts over the conservation of private areas in the state. The main conflicts occurred over the existing environmental liabilities and the quantity of legal reserves in forest areas and, to try to solve it, the state government created, in 2008, a law – the Legal Mato Grosso – that divides SLAPR in two sections, postponing the official acceptance of the legal reserves liabilities. This new “economical project” (of adaptation) exceeds the previous one because it not only legitimates the production but also the occupation style of the state. The idea is to “make official” every state rural property the way they are now, even those that were illegally deforested after the year 2000. Abstract: The Alta Floresta Auriferous Province (MT) is located in the south of the Amazonian Craton. Within this province, the Peixoto de Azevedo-Novo Mundo region has been one of the main gold- producing district. In this region, basement gneisses yielded ages varying from 2816 ± 4 Ma (Pb-Pb zircon), in paleossoma, to 1984 ±7 Ma (U-Pb zircon), as well as TDM = 2.62 Ga and ?Nd (1984)= ¿4,35. These data suggest the occurrence of an heterogeneous basement which formed predominantly by crustal-sourced rocks. The Archean age is correlated with the basement (Xingu Complex) of the Central Amazonian Province, whereas the Paleoproterozoic age marks an episode of reworking. On the basis of field relationships, geochemistry and geochronology, five granite suites have been recognized in the region and coined as Novo Mundo, Nhandu, Peixoto, Santa Helena Antigo e Santa Helena Jovem. The Novo Mundo Granite is sub-alkaline to calcalkaline, slightly peraluminous, with medium to high potassium, and shows compositions of syenogranite- monzogranite- monzonite. The syenogranite yielded a Pb-Pb age of 1964 Ma, whereas the monzogranite an age of 1970 Ma. The monzonite dated by SHRIMP (U-Pb zircon) displayed an age of 1956 Ma. The syenogranite presented TDM=2,76 Ga and ?Nd(1964) = -7,62, whereas the monzonite yielded TDM=2,55 Ga and ?Nd (1956) = -4,58. The Nhandu granite is dominated by biotite monzogranite and is commonly calc-alkaline, metaluminous to peraluminous and with medium potassium. The age of the Nhandu biotite monzogranite was defined at 1848±17 Ma (U-Pb on zircon). The Peixoto granite is represented by isotropic, equigranular to porphyritic biotite monzogranite, hornblende-biotite granodiorite and biotite tonalite of calc-alkaline nature, slightly peraluminous to metaluminous and with medium potassium. A Pb-Pb zircon age of 1792 ±2 Ma was obtained for the biotite monzogranite. The occurrence of restricted gneisses of Archean age intruded by late to post tectonic Paleoproterozoic granite suites with ages > 1.95 Ga and TDM > 2.4 Ga, suggest that crustal generation in the region may have locally taken place at ages older than previously defined for the Ventuari- Tapajós Province (1.95-1.8 Ga and TDM of 2.2-1.9 Ga).The gold deposits hosted by the granitic and gneissic terranes of the Peixoto de Azevedo - Novo Mundo region comprise the following styles: (i) lodes in milonites along shears zones; (ii) disseminated, particularly in the Novo Mundo and Santa Helena Jovem granites (1.967±3 Ma); and (iii) quartz veins and stockworks hosted by the Nhandu and Peixoto granites. The Novo Mundo granite is an important temporal marker for disseminated gold mineralization in the Alta Floresta Province, having as example the Novo Mundo gold deposit (Luizão Prospect). The mineralization consists of quartz (5-20%), sericite (40- 50%), chlorite (5- 20%) and pyrite (5- 35%). The Santa Helena Antigo granite (1986 ± 6 Ma) and the Santa Helena Jovem granite (1967 ± 3 Ma) are the main hosts of the Santa Helena gold deposit. Both are calc-alkaline, medium to high K. The Santa Helena gold deposit comprises two types of mineralization: auriferous quartz lodes with pyrite and mylonite rock bands; vein systems (granitic ore) with sulfides (pyrite ± chalcopyrite ± galena) and sulfosalts (Bi+S+Cu±Ag±Te±Se±Me ±Pb), hosted preferentially by the Santa Helena Jovem granite. Both the Novo Mundo and the Santa Helena gold deposits reveal a series of similarities to Intrusion Related Gold Systems

Anthropogenic climate change still poorly understood cause changes in global weather systems, leading several countries to cope with social, environmental and economic issues. Brazil a major exporter of grains and heavily dependent on agriculture may suffer significant losses in areas of production, with increasing temperature and decrease in rainfall rates. In the last twenty years the land policy and private initiatives in the Brazilian state of Mato Grosso have converted forest into several crops and agricultural activities. These changes could cause severe consequences to the hydrological cycle at local, regional and global level. The study of historical rainfall data for the past 30 years, concurrently with interpretations of satellite imagery as well as changes of land use, is of great importance to confirm the trends of precipitation in areas highly affected by anthropogenic activities, as the case of BR - 163 in the state of Mato Grosso. The analysis of the research is limited to a comparison of a control area (non deforested) in the northwestern part of Mato Grosso, with a pioneer front area (deforested with intense land use) in the north portion of BR-163 in Mato Grosso. With the crossing of land use data NDVI (vegetation index), deforestation and meteorological stations (rainfall) by remote sensing tools and geo-statistics methods (LANDSAT images from 1977, 1987, 1997, 2007)(IDW and Ordinary Kriging) the 30 years range of hydrological cycle in the northern state is addressed. Therefore, this information is crucial to understand the interrelationship of land use with regional climate and its consequences for the four pillars of sustainable development.

Abstract:
This report presents an analysis of the threat posed by active volcanoes in Canada and outlines directives to bring Canadian volcano monitoring and research into alignment with global best practices. We analyse 28 Canadian volcanoes in terms of their relative threat to people, aviation and infrastructure. The methodology we apply to assess volcanic threat was developed by the United States Geological Survey (USGS) as part of the 2005 National Volcano Early Warning System (NVEWS). Each volcano is scored on a number of hazard and exposure factors, producing an overall threat score. The overall threat scores are then assigned to five threat categories ranging from Very Low to Very High. We adjusted the methodology slightly to better suit Canadian volcano conditions by adding an additional knowledge uncertainty score; this does not affect the threat scoring or ranking. Our threat assessment places two volcanoes into the Very High threat category (Mt. Meager and Mt. Garibaldi). Three Canadian volcanoes score in the High threat category (Mt. Cayley, Mt. Price and Mt. Edziza) and two volcanoes score in the Moderate threat category (the Nass River group and Mt. Silverthrone). We compare the ranked Canadian volcanoes to similarly scored volcanoes in the USA and assess the current levels of volcano monitoring against internationally recognised monitoring strategies. We find that even the most thoroughly-studied volcano in Canada (Mt. Meager) falls significantly short of the recommended monitoring level (Mt. Meager is currently monitored at a level commensurate with a Very Low threat edifice, according to NVEWS recommendations). All other Canadian volcanoes are unmonitored (other than falling within a regional seismic network emplaced to monitor tectonic earthquakes). Based on the relative threat and scientific uncertainty surrounding some Canadian volcanoes, we outline five strategies to improve volcano monitoring in Canada and lower the uncertainty about eruption style and frequency: installation of real-time seismic stations at all Very High and High threat volcanoes, comprehensive lithofacies studies at Mt. Garibaldi in order to reduce uncertainty surrounding the frequency and style of volcanism, hazard mapping at Mt. Garibaldi and Mt. Cayley and publication of existing hazard analyses and mapping for Mt. Meager as a comprehensive hazard map, regular satellite-based ground deformation monitoring at all Very High to Moderate threat edifices, and, finally, installation of a landslide detection and alerting system at Mt. Meager.

Abstract:
The US Highway 191 (US-191)/Montana Highway 64 (MT-64) Wildlife & Transportation Assessment (the “Assessment”) improves understanding of the issues affecting driver safety, wildlife mortality, and wildlife movement along the major routes that connect Yellowstone National Park, the Custer Gallatin National Forest, and other public lands to the growing population centers of Bozeman, Big Sky, and nearby communities in Southwest Montana. By engaging personnel from multiple federal, state, and local agencies along with key stakeholders to examine problems and possibilities through the lens of spatial ecology, the US-191/MT-64 Wildlife & Transportation Assessment brings new insight into the impact of two major roads that unite local communities yet divide the landscape and natural habitats. The information included in this report should inform and support area communities and agency decision-makers to select and pursue wildlife accommodation options. With the passage of the Infrastructure Investment and Jobs Act of 2021, significant funds for wildlife accommodation measures are available nationwide on a competitive basis. The US-191/MT-64 Wildlife & Transportation Assessment better equips part of Southwest Montana’s gateway to Yellowstone National Park to take advantage of new funding opportunities.
